Understanding the Basics: What Do You Need to Know?
Before diving into the advanced certificate, it’s crucial to understand what PK and modeling techniques entail. Pharmacokinetics is the study of how a drug moves through the body—how it is absorbed, distributed, metabolized, and excreted. Modeling techniques use mathematical and statistical methods to predict and optimize these processes.
# Key Skills You Will Develop
1. Pharmacokinetic Modeling: Learn to create and analyze models that predict how a drug behaves in the body. This includes understanding different models like one-compartment, two-compartment, and nonlinear mixed-effects models.
2. Data Analysis: Utilize statistical tools to analyze PK data and draw meaningful conclusions.
3. Software Proficiency: Master the use of specialized software like WinNonlin, Phoenix/NCA, and NONMEM, which are essential for PK modeling.
4. Regulatory Compliance: Understand the FDA and EMA guidelines for PK data analysis and reporting.
5. Communication Skills: Effectively communicate your findings to multidisciplinary teams, including clinicians, statisticians, and regulatory affairs personnel.

Career Opportunities
An advanced certificate in PK and modeling techniques opens up a wide array of career paths:
1. Clinical Research Analyst: Work with clinical data to support drug development and regulatory submissions.
2. Modeling and Simulation Specialist: Develop and validate PK models to optimize drug dosing regimens.
3. Data Scientist: Utilize advanced statistical techniques to analyze large datasets and inform drug development strategies.
4. Regulatory Affairs Specialist: Ensure that PK data and models comply with regulatory requirements.
5. Academic Researcher: Contribute to the scientific community by conducting research and publishing findings.
